Greg:

That's great! Thanks very much for the photographs.. (I collect them BTW - I call them my RIC porn collection)

Yours is TB 372, which may be one of the earliest copies of the production model 12 string, perhaps the 10th or 12th one they made. Please add your guitars to the registery, hopefully with a few images too.. The database is important to track numbers

Here is what is in the registry for that model. Exactly six of them... Somewhere I seem to recall reading that RIC made
only 40 or 50 of them that first year - in reaction to the Tom Petty DAMN THE TORPEDOES lp cover which came out the previous fall.

Model Strings Special Finish MFG Date Serial Registered Location Remarks

620 12 Fireglo 1980-11 TK4610 May 07 2008 Ontario, Canada IMG
620 12 Fireglo 1980-06 TF2140 Jul 11 2002 Ontario, Canada IMG
625 12 Fireglo 1980-04 TD1285 Aug 29 1999 Texas, USA
620 12 Fireglo 1980-02 TB663 Jan 08 2008 Nevada, USA CI
620 12 Fireglo 1980-02 TB444 Feb 06 2008 Texas, USA IMG S
620 12 Jetglo 1980-01 TA125 Oct 08 2008 Colorado, USA CI


These pre-1980 examples were all prototypes or special orders... Richard Smith's book mentions a 1969 620 / 12 with three pickups going to Canada too.

620 12 Fireglo 1970-11 JK3828 Aug 06 2001 Italy
620 12 Fireglo 1965-11 EK407 Feb 15 1999 Quebec, Canada
625 12 Fireglo 1964-11 DK695 Mar 26 2008 California, USA CI
625 12 Fireglo 1963-12 CM108 Feb 10 2009 California, USA CI


My two FG 620 /12's were TF 2140 (lost in a fire 1991) and TK 4610 which I bought off Ebay last year. These guitars are really under appreciated IMHO, but I just love the the smaller headstocks and the old style tuners... The fireglos have aged so beautifully too...

Again congrats on a great guitar and kudos to you for trying to get it back to original. One last little detail, my June guitar had a TRC with no model number, while the November guitar the TRC says model 620. Both are therefore correct for period images from this time period. (It would likely be very hard to find a TRC that says model 620 these days).
